In recent years, the popularity of residence daycare services happens to be increasing. With additional and more moms and dads seeking flexible and affordable childcare options, residence daycare providers have become a well known option for many households. But as with any style of childcare arrangement, there are both benefits and drawbacks to take into account regarding home daycare.
One of many great things about home daycare is the personalized care and attention that children receive. Unlike bigger daycare centers, house daycare providers routinely have smaller categories of children to look after, letting them offer each child much more personalized attention. This is often particularly beneficial for kiddies whom might need additional help or have unique needs. In addition, house daycare providers frequently have even more freedom inside their schedules, allowing them to accommodate the requirements of working moms and dads who may have non-traditional work hours.
Another advantage of house daycare is the home-like environment that children can encounter. In a property daycare setting, children can play and learn in a cushty and familiar environment, which will help all of them feel better and relaxed. This is often specifically good for younger kids which may struggle with separation anxiety when becoming remaining in a bigger, more institutionalized daycare setting.
Residence daycare providers in addition frequently have more freedom with regards to curriculum and tasks. In a home daycare setting, providers have the freedom to tailor their particular programs to the specific needs and interests of this kiddies in their attention. This will probably provide for even more creative and personalized understanding experiences, which can be very theraputic for children of all centuries.
Despite these advantages, additionally there are some downsides to take into account in terms of home daycare. One of many problems that moms and dads may have could be the insufficient oversight and regulation in residence daycare services. Unlike bigger daycare centers, which are often at the mercy of rigid certification needs and laws, house daycare providers may not be held into the same criteria. This will boost concerns concerning the quality and safety of treatment that kiddies obtain within these options.
Another potential drawback of residence daycare may be the limited socialization opportunities that kiddies may have. In property daycare environment, kiddies are typically only interacting with a tiny number of colleagues, which might not supply them with equivalent standard of socialization and experience of diverse experiences which they would receive in a bigger daycare center. This can be a problem for parents just who worth socialization and peer connection as essential components of their child's development.
Furthermore, home daycare providers may deal with difficulties when it comes to balancing their caregiving obligations using their private everyday lives. Numerous home daycare providers are self-employed and may find it difficult to get a hold of a work-life balance, particularly when these are typically looking after young ones in their own domiciles. This can cause burnout and stress, that could in the end impact the grade of care that kids obtain.
In general, house daycare are outstanding selection for people in search of versatile and personalized childcare options.
